Transaction 70750917c0f266662daf6cbf756114c6fed5eb0a97d1d1fbcca012c250b5cede
1 Input
1 Output
-
70750917c0f266662daf6cbf756114c6fed5eb0a97d1d1fbcca012c250b5cede:0
- value
- 182896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 173b5fd7895a867a961606bff29baaea94c5aa79 OP_EQUAL
- address
- 33orbMrEEXTx4hFDbtAedfrhM8mUC5SMu7